该任务包括从剪贴板粘贴,并且希望用户从记事本或excel文件粘贴到一列,因此它看起来像这样

123
233
22.222

等等

我需要用空白空间替换\ r,并且尝试了许多不同的方法,但是所有方法都将\ r留在了其中。最初,数据看起来像这样123 \ r \ n233 \ r \ n22.222 \ r \ n

我需要将\ n留在其中,而将\ r移出。

到目前为止,这是我的代码

pasteResultsFromClipboard: function () {

        var clipText = window.clipboardData.getData('Text');
        clipText =  clipText.replace(/(?:\\[r])+/g, "");


        var rows = clipText.split('\n');

    },

最佳答案

clipText = clipText.replace(/\r/g, "");

关于javascript - 从javascript数组元素中剥离\r,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/36338836/

10-10 00:18